Job responsibilities
The Material Handler 3 is responsible for unloading all product that comes in and reporting of the quality. This position is exposed to multiple refrigerated areas within production and operates a forklift or motorized lifting devices to move raw product, finished product, materials, and supplies as directed inside and outside of production.

What you will Do:
- Ensure compliance with and maintain all GMP/PPE/Safety, HACCP & Sanitation guidelines and processes.
- Unload raw product, affixing assigned lot numbers to each bin or box that comes in. Record all items received in appropriate receiving form and upon completion, compare with bill of lading for accuracy. Record any discrepancies.
- Weigh all bins of lettuce from each load, recording weight on lettuce receiving form.
- Minimize downtime by providing production with materials needed for each day. Responsible for communicating with gatekeeper and coordinator regarding inventory issues and ensuring efficient changeovers.
- Maintain proper rotation (FIFO).
- Be cross-trained and able to perform line feeding, rotating, and picking responsibilities.

Physical Work Environment:
While performing the duties of this job, the associate will be required to perform repetitive movements. The associate regularly works near moving mechanical parts and is regularly exposed to extreme cold. The associate frequently works in high, precarious places. The associate is occasionally exposed to wet and/or humid conditions, fumes or airborne particles, toxic or caustic chemicals, and risk of electrical shock. The noise level in the work environment is usually loud.
